Billy Bob has 23 coins that total $1.70. He found some nickels and dimes in the couch.
How many nickels and dimes did he find?
Answer:
12 nickels
11 dimes
Step-by-step explanation:
Let n = no. of nickels
d = no. of dimes
5n = value of nickels in cents
10d = value of dimes in cents
170 = total value in cents
(1) n + d = 23 (2) 5n + 10d = 170
d = 23 - n 5n + 10(23 - n) = 170
5n + 230 - 10n = 170
- 5n = - 60
n = 12 nickels
d = 23 - 12 = 11 dimes
Check: 12(5) + 11(10) = 60 + 110 = 170 cents or $1.70

Enter an equation for the line of symmetry for the function f (x) = 5x^2 – 20x + 3.
Answer:
x = 2.
Step-by-step explanation:
First convert to vertex form:
f(x) = 5x^2 - 20x + 3
= 5(x^2 - 4x) + 3
= 5 [(x - 2)^2 - 4] + 3
= 5(x - 2)^2 -20 + 3
= 5(x - 2)^2 - 17.
The line of symmetry is x = 2.
